                EPHRAIM, Utah – The Western Nebraska Community College women's and men's soccer teams dropped contests on Saturday in Ephraim, Utah.

                The Cougar women dropped a 6-0 contest to Yavapai College while the Cougar men fell to No. 17 Snow College 3-1.

                The women's contest saw Yavapai score three times in each half. Yavapai scored in the 21 minute on a goal by Morgan McLane and then Sophia Fottrell scored twice in the 37th and 40 minute for the 3-0 halftime lead.

                Yavapai added two goals in the 67th minute from Reagan Peterson and Gracey Fowlkes and then capped off the game with a goal from Jill Young in the 81st minute.

                Yavapai had 31 shots, 11 of which were on goal. WNCC tallied five shots, three of which were on goal. Julia Santos had two shots while Adryana Rodriguez, Nia Trevino, and Stefanie Ceja-Gomez each had one.

                Rory Weizenegger had five saves in net.

                The men's contest saw Snow College score twice in the first as Kade Davis scored in the 33rd minute and then Omer Sagiv scored in the 43rd minute for the 2-0 halftime lead.

                Snow added a third goal in the 78th minute. Two minutes later, WNCC got on the scoreboard as Tomoaki Kamiya had a free kick and punched it into the net.

                Snow had 14 shots, eight of which were on goal. WNCC tallied 12 shots, six of which were on goal. Anthony Lemus had three shots while Kamiya and Randall Jacques each had two shots.

                Ever Zubia had five saves in net for the Cougar men.

                Both teams will be back in action next weekend then they travel to Estherville, Iowa, to face Iowa Lake Community College and St. Louis Community College.
